Mitsubishi Outlander: Manual type
Pull the seat adjusting lever and adjust the seat forward or backward to the
desired position, and release the adjusting lever.

Warning
► To ensure the seat is locked securely, try to move the seat forward or backward
without using the adjusting lever.
